Broken panes

The best way to keep your double-glazed windows in good shape is to examine them on a regular basis, and to clean them at least once per year with a mild detergent. Avoid harsh chemical cleaners, as they can damage the insulating seals. Also, avoid using high-pressure washers on your windows, as the water could get into the sash and cause a leak. In the end, if you choose to apply chemicals to your windows, be sure they're safe for them and apply them in a controlled manner.

It's important to fix the damaged window as soon as you can. It's not just an accident hazard however, it could also affect your home's energy efficiency and cause higher utility bills. A damaged window can let cold air into your home and warm air out, leading to an energy loss.

Fortunately fixing a damaged or broken window isn't a big task however, it will take some time and effort. First, you'll need to take out any old glass and glazing points. You can do this using pliers, a putty knife or a small flat-head screwdriver. Wearing eye protection carefully pry out the old glazing points. After the old glass is removed, clean the L-shaped channel that runs around the window frame. Then, sand the bare wood to a smooth surface and seal it with linseed oil or a clear wood sealer.

The next step is to cut the replacement glass to the desired size. You can do this using a template for paper and pencil, or the edge of an intact pane as a guide. Utilize a glass cutter as well as a razor to cut out the new glass. Once the damaged window is gone then you can replace it with a new pane of glass, along with the glazing points and compound.

Window replacement is more expensive than one pane repair, but it's worth it in the long in the long run. A faulty window can no longer offer the same insulation, so it's essential to replace it as quickly as possible.

One of the most common issues with double-glazed windows is that they may create condensation between the panes of glass. This could be due to a variety of reasons, such as a lack of ventilation and high humidity in the structure or room. To prevent condensation make sure that the humidity is as low as you can. You can also utilize extractors on window frames or vents in order to let fresh air into.

If you are experiencing draughts or condensation the seal on your double-glazed windows has likely failed. A damaged seal could lead to a loss of insulation, which can increase heating costs. If you're not sure whether your seals are failing test your hand over the frame of the window to determine if it feels cold and humid. This could be an indication that seals have failed as well as an oversaturated Desiccant in the sealed unit.

tired-worker-looks-out-of-the-window-2021-08-29-00-59-51-utc.jpgThe Desiccant absorbs moisture from the air. When the Desiccant is saturated, it will break down and white dustflakes will float around the interior of the sealed unit. This is a good indication that the seals are not working properly and a replacement unit is required.
